Moms Waffles Dressing
Ingredients:
sugars, brown
wheat flour, white, all-purpose, unenriched
butter, without salt
milk, fluid, 1% fat, without added vitamin a and vitamin d
spices, cinnamon, ground
Directions:
Use a small saucepan and have all your ingredients ready.
Put the brown sugar and flour in the pan as it is heating over a medium heat.
Use a small whisk to blend the flour and brown sugar together.
Once blended, then add the butter and continue to whisk until it melted, only a few seconds.
Next, gradually add the milk, about a 1/4 cup at a time.
Continue whisking.
As it starts to thicken add another 1/4 cup of milk.
When that is starting to thicken add more milk and so on until all the milk is added to the sauce.
Then turn the heat to low so that it continues at a low simmer.
Keep an eye on it, stirring occasionally.
Once its nice and thick, add the cinnamon and stir well.
Then remove from heat.
Pour over toasted waffles and top with a sprinkle of cinnamon.
Or even some cinnamon whipped topping!
